Shanghai held a press conference to introduce CIIE preparations on July 27, 2026. /CGTN July 27 marks the 100-day-countdown to the 9th China International Import Expo, which will take place between November 5 and 10, 2026. According to a press conference held on July 27, 53 countries and 3 international organizations have confirmed to show at a national pavilion. Romania, Moldova and the United Nations Development Programme will be participating for the first time. More than 1,200 organizations from 99 countries and regions have also confirmed to show company pavilions and 265 of them are Fortune 500 companies. Over 70 companies will showcase their latest technologies in AI and new materials. According to the size of the exhibition areas, the United States is now top among all foreign nations. The CIIE will upgrade its special section for African countries that have diplomatic relations with China, encouraging the Global South to actively use the platform of CIIE.
